Nota
O acesso a esta página requer autorização. Pode tentar iniciar sessão ou alterar os diretórios.
O acesso a esta página requer autorização. Pode tentar alterar os diretórios.
Nos primeiros dias do Microsoft Windows, os aplicativos e o sistema operacional armazenavam valores de configuração em arquivos "INI" (inicialização). Isso forneceu uma maneira simples de armazenar valores de estado que poderiam ser preservados de uma sessão do Windows para a próxima. No entanto, como o ambiente Windows se tornou mais complexo, um novo sistema de armazenamento de informações persistentes sobre o sistema operacional e aplicativos foi necessário. O Registro do Windows foi criado para armazenar dados sobre hardware e software.
O gerenciador de configuração do modo kernel do Windows gerencia o registro. Se o seu driver precisa saber sobre alterações no registro, ele pode usar as rotinas do gerenciador de configuração para fazê-lo, registrando retornos de chamada em dados específicos do registro. Em seguida, quando os dados no registo mudam, o callback é acionado e você pode executar o código a fim de processar as informações de callback no seu driver.
As rotinas que fornecem uma interface direta para o gerenciador de configuração são prefixadas com as letras "Cm"; por exemplo, CmRegisterCallback. Para obter uma lista de rotinas do Configuration Manager, consulte Rotinas do Configuration Manager.
Além de chamar diretamente o gerenciador de configuração, há outras maneiras de trabalhar com o registro em seu driver. Para obter mais informações sobre como usar o Registro em um driver, consulte Rotinas de objeto de chave do Registro e Chaves do Registro para drivers.